Dawn Break Poem by Cyrus Diaz

Dawn Break



stillness ruled
oh, in this bleak
may day night
not even a single
crickets chirp
has reached my ears - -
stillness cavernously
deafening,
silence reverberates,
scorned the heart
with grief and sorrow,
why having to live
alone in this weak
and frail resting home
drowned you to mourn?
mourn, in the sorrows
of your own,
in vain i scream,
in plight, I complain
transient sorrow
only leaves the soul
with scars and stain,
then a voice from
within I heard,
whispering,
'sleep, sleep
that your sorrow
may break,
break together
with the dawn'
